How much does it cost to rent a home in Downtown Wenatchee?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Downtown Wenatchee 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,150 | $1,650 | $2,800 |
| Downtown Wenatchee 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,897 | $1,595 | $4,995 |

Cheapest Available Downtown Wenatchee Apartments for Rent
 The cheapest available apartment rental in the Downtown Wenatchee area of Wenatchee, WA is a Studio unit found at 600 Riverside priced from $1,395. Riverside 9 has the second lowest priced unit, which is a Studio apartment currently listed from $1,395. Here are the most affordable Downtown Wenatchee apartments for rent in Wenatchee, WA: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| 600 Riverside | Cornice Studio | Studio,1BA | $1,395 |
| Riverside 9 | Cameo | Studio,1BA | $1,395 |
| Riverfront Village | Studio | Studio,1BA | $1,495 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Downtown Wenatchee
What type of rentals are currently available in Downtown Wenatchee?
There are currently 28 Apartments for Rent in Downtown Wenatchee, WA with pricing that ranges from $1,000 to $2,150. There are also 12 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Downtown Wenatchee ranging from $1,595 to $4,995.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Downtown Wenatchee?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Downtown Wenatchee ranges from $1,595 to $4,995 with an average monthly rent of $2,523.
